For Brodeur and Xio:
Quote:
Lynn Henning of the Detroit News reports that the Tigers have "strong interest" in Cuban defector Yoenis Cespedes.
Add another team to the list, which includes no fewer than at least a half dozen that have interest in the talented Cuban. Cespedes, 26, is expected to command a deal in the $20-30 million range and probably will need little to no time in the minor leagues before being ready for a starting job in the outfield.

The SS market is ridiculously bad (as usual). You've got Reyes who should get 9 figures but comes with huge injury risk. Then there's Rollins who is regressing, getting old and will cost a lot. After those two there is really nothing else but league average or below. I guess Barmes would be the best remaining guy. Ughhh.
